Deploy this web interface to your data center for user account control

Should you’re on the lookout for a device to chop down on the time you spend managing person accounts, let Usermin hand a few of these duties over to your end-users.

Network administrator working in data center

Picture: Gorodenkoff/Shutterstock

Generally you simply want or need to give customers a bit extra management over their accounts. Or possibly you need to hand over some easy duties, so your IT workers is not all the time bombarded with requests that might in any other case be dealt with by end-users.

SEE: From begin to end: Learn how to deploy an LDAP server (TechRepublic Premium)

Sounds a bit harmful, would not it? It would not need to be. There are many web-based instruments for end-users that assist make it doable for them to do issues like:

  • Learn, ship and schedule e mail.
  • Create cron jobs.
  • Change information and folders permissions.
  • Add/obtain information and folders.
  • Safe net directories.
  • Setup and use GPG encryption.
  • Change password.
  • Setup SSH key authentication.

One specific device is out there for such duties and may simply be deployed in your Debian- or Purple Hat-based Linux distributions inside your information heart. That device is a stripped-down model of Webmin, referred to as Usermin. It is not a device so that you can handle your customers however quite designed for normal, non-root customers on a Unix system. Usermin limits customers to duties that they might be capable to carry out if logged in through SSH or on the console. So, when you’re snug handing over that stage of management to your customers, Usermin would possibly prevent a couple of predictable distractions all through the day.

I’ll present you learn how to deploy this device, so your customers can take over a few of the duties that will usually be on the shoulders of your admins. 

What you will want

The one belongings you’ll must get Usermin up and operating are a supported Linux distribution and a person with sudo privileges. I will be demonstrating on Ubuntu Server 20.04.

Learn how to set up the required dependencies

The very first thing to be achieved is the set up of the required dependencies. I am going to assume you recurrently replace and improve your servers, so I will not trouble reminding you to replace and improve.

With that stated, log into your Ubuntu server and set up the dependencies with the command:

sudo apt-get set up perl libnet-ssleay-perl openssl libauthen-pam-perl libpam-runtime libio-pty-perl unzip -y

Learn how to obtain and set up Usermin

With the dependencies out of the way in which, we will now set up Usermin. Usermin is not accessible in the usual repositories, nor does it have a repository of its personal. To put in the device, it’s essential to obtain the installer file. Earlier than you challenge the obtain command, examine the obtain web site, to make sure you’re knocking down the most recent model. 

Obtain the most recent model (as of this writing, 1.823) with the command:

wget https://sourceforge.web/initiatives/webadmin/information/usermin/1.823/usermin_1.823_all.deb

As soon as the file obtain is full, set up Usermin with the command:

sudo dpkg -i usermin*.deb

Permit the set up to finish after which begin/allow the service with the instructions:

sudo systemctl begin usermin
sudo systemctl allow usermin

Lastly, open the required port within the firewall with the command:

sudo ufw permit 20000

Learn how to entry Usermin

To entry the Usermin web-based interface, launch a browser and level it to https://SERVER:20000 (the place SERVER is the IP tackle or area of the internet hosting server). You will be introduced with the Usermin login window (Determine A).

Determine A


The Usermin login window.

Log in with an everyday person and you will be greeted by the Usermin dashboard (Determine B), the place you can begin managing your person account.

Determine B


The Usermin dashboard is prepared for work.

And that is all there may be to deploying Usermin. This straightforward device would possibly prevent and your IT workers a little bit of frustration all through your day. Customers can now change their very own passwords, handle e mail and rather more.

Additionally see

Recent Articles


Related Stories

Leave A Reply

Please enter your comment!
Please enter your name here

Stay on op - Ge the daily news in your inbox